Keto Philly Cheesesteak Roll-Ups Recipe

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 8 roll ups 1x
  • Diet: Low Carb

Keto Philly Cheesesteak Roll Ups are a low-carb, delicious twist on the classic Philly cheesesteak sandwich. Thinly sliced roast beef is sautéed with bell peppers, onions, and mushrooms, then wrapped in provolone cheese slices and baked until bubbly. This recipe is perfect for a quick keto-friendly meal or appetizer that’s packed with savory flavors and satisfying texture.


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 pound thinly sliced roast beef
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• 1 medium onion, thinly sliced
  • 1 cup sliced mushrooms
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 8 slices provolone cheese

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to prepare for baking the roll ups later.
  2. Sauté Vegetables: In a large skillet over medium heat, heat the olive oil. Add the sliced green bell pepper, onion, and mushrooms. Sauté the vegetables for about 5 minutes until they soften and become fragrant.
  3. Add Roast Beef and Season: Add the thinly sliced roast beef to the skillet with the vegetables. Sprinkle the garlic powder, salt, and pepper evenly over the mixture. Stir well and cook for another 3-5 minutes until the beef is warmed through and the vegetables are tender.
  4. Prepare Cheese Slices: Lay out the provolone cheese slices flat on a clean surface, ready to be filled.
  5. Assemble Roll Ups: Place a generous portion of the beef and vegetable mixture onto each slice of provolone cheese.
  6. Roll and Place: Carefully roll each provolone slice tightly around the filling, making sure the filling stays inside. Place each roll seam-side down in a baking dish to prevent them from unrolling during baking.
  7. Bake: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 10 minutes until the cheese melts and becomes bubbly.
  8. Serve: Remove the baking dish from the oven and let the roll ups rest for a few minutes before serving. This allows them to set and be easier to handle.

Notes

  • You can substitute roast beef with thinly sliced steak or leftover steak for different textures.
  • Feel free to add other keto-friendly veggies like jalapeños or spinach for extra flavor and nutrients.
  • If you prefer a sharper cheese, try using sharp provolone or even mozzarella for a milder taste.
  • These roll ups are great for meal prepping and can be refrigerated for up to 3 days.
  • Make sure to roll the cheese slices tightly to avoid leaks during baking.
